On 22 Nov 2005, at 14:45, CJ Larson wrote:
It looks like you need to clear it, since you float the ul. Try this
(and let us know if it works):
#topnavcontainer:after {
clear: both;
content: .;
display: block;
height: 0;
visibility: hidden;
}
